Accredo Healthcare 5500 $2.4B United States Change Healthcare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ill Revenue Cycle Management 2019 n/a
In 2019, Accredo implemented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ill for Revenue Cycle Management to support its billing, reimbursement, and preauthorization operations. The deployment targeted the Billing & Reimbursement Commercial Billing Team and Pre Authorization Representatives, including staff operating out of Memphis, Tennessee, to centralize claims submission and payer communication workflows. The implementation emphasized electronic claims submission, rejection management, payer remittance lookup, and preauthorization processing.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ill was configured to handle pharmaceutical billing both as paper and electronic claims, and to interface with Emdeon Vision, Novologix, Availity, and Navinet for claims routing and status inquiries, with remittance reference via Emdeon and US Bank Payment Consolidator, and patient account coordination with RX Home. Operational governance formalized standardized rejection resolution and coordinated preauthorization workflows, with staff contacting provider offices and payors and transmitting authorization information electronically. The deployment aligned billing and preauthorization business functions around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ill to centralize claim filing, payer interactions, and remittance research.
Bartlett Regional Hospital Healthcare 600 $98M United States Change Healthcare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ill Revenue Cycle Management 2021 n/a
In 2021 Bartlett Regional Hospital implemented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ill as its Revenue Cycle Management platform. The deployment leveraged existing hospital IT infrastructure including VMware hosts, on site servers and NAS that support imaging and departmental systems, with the application provisioned to centralize billing processes for inpatient and outpatient services across the facility.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ill was configured to support core billing modules including claims management, electronic claim submission, denial management and remittance posting, consistent with Revenue Cycle Management functional workflows. Interfaces were implemented using HL7 feeds from RIS and ADT where available, and configuration aligned with the hospital's radiology tooling such as Change Healthcare Radiology Solutions so that radiology exam orders and PACS reporting could trigger billing events. The rollout and operational coverage prioritized Radiology, Emergency Department, ICU, orthopedic, cardiology, dental and physical therapy departments, with platform training and desktop support provided to physicians, technologists and departmental staff. System administration and ongoing support responsibilities rested with the hospital's PACS and departmental IT team, using remote support tooling and VMware operations for maintenance, configuration management and incident response.
Centra Health Insurance 8100 $1.6B United States Change Healthcare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ill Revenue Cycle Management 2017 n/a
In 2017, Centra Health implemented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ill as its primary Revenue Cycle Management application. The deployment targeted enterprise billing and claims orchestration for hospital and radiology services, centralizing claim creation, electronic claims submission and accounts receivable workflows across the organization.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ill was configured to support billing and claims processing workflows, including claim generation, edits and scrubbing, electronic claims transmission and electronic remittance processing, aligning with core Revenue Cycle Management functional modules. Role based access and workflow configuration were implemented to support revenue cycle analysts, billing staff and denial management teams. Operational integration extended to imaging and clinical systems that Centra Health administers, specifically McKesson PACS, RIS and Powerscrbe 360, enabling more direct handoffs between radiology order and result systems and billing records for procedural charge capture. Governance and operational controls centralized revenue cycle oversight, formalized handoffs between radiology, patient accounting and billing operations, and standardized claims workflows across sites.
Chester County Orthopedic Assoc Healthcare 70 $10M United States Change Healthcare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ill Revenue Cycle Management 2020 n/a
In 2020, Chester County Orthopedic Assoc implemented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ill as its core billing platform. The deployment positioned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ill squarely within Revenue Cycle Management to centralize claims submission, electronic remittance handling, and accounts receivable workflows for outpatient orthopedics and associated therapy services. The implementation emphasized standard Revenue Cycle Management capabilities including claim editing and scrub rules, batch claim submission to payers, electronic remittance advice handling and 835 export preparation, and denial tracking and appeals workflows.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ill was used to support auditing of missing office, surgery and DME charges, research of billing rejections and unbilled claims, and management of bulk projects for denied and underpaid claims. Operational integrations reflected the provider ecosystem in the notes, with the practice’s ambulatory clinical system eClinicalWorks used for registration and charge capture, and Change Healthcare acting as the clearinghouse for claim transmission. The workflow extended to external portals and payment networks explicitly named in the source, including NaviNet, Availity, PEAR Portal, Jopari, ECHO, lnstaMed, VPay, Zelis, and Cerner for hospital records, and involved uploading claims into a third party vendor portal CBIZ for contracted hospital orthopedics follow up. Governance and process changes centered on accounts receivable and payer management, with Insurance Billing Specialists performing claim edits, denials analysis, appeal preparation, remittance interpretation, and coordination with payer provider relations. The operational scope covered outpatient orthopedics, occupational health and physical therapy billing functions, with workflows to track issues through to resolution, escalate trends to supervisors, and route complex payer projects to assigned network coordinators. The narrative links Chester County Orthopedic Assoc,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ill, Revenue Cycle Management and core business functions of billing and accounts receivable, reflecting an implementation focused on claim lifecycle orchestration, remittance processing, and structured denial and appeals management.
Commonwealth Health Healthcare 500 $100M United States Change Healthcare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ill Revenue Cycle Management 2017 n/a
In 2017 Commonwealth Health implemented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ill to centralize Revenue Cycle Management across its health system. The deployment was positioned to support core billing and claims operations, aligning the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ill application with enterprise revenue functions and patient access workflows. The implementation focused on standard Revenue Cycle Management capabilities, including electronic claims submission, remittance processing, denial and rejection management, and accounts receivable orchestration. Change Healthcare Emdeon ExpressBill was configured to enforce billing rules, payer adjudication logic, and back-end billing automation, while provisioning user roles for coding, billing, and collections teams. Integrations included direct operational links to the health systems clinical and financial systems, specifically Cerner Millennium and Medhost EHRs, and HMS Financials. These integrations enabled claims data handoff from clinical encounters and financial posting into the general ledger, supporting coordinated workflows between billing, patient access, and finance teams. Governance and rollout emphasized centralized charge and coding control, defined denial management workflows, and staged operational adoption across revenue cycle functions. Training and configuration governance were applied to ensure consistent billing rule sets and to manage changes to payer logic and adjudication processes.
